Birth: 1788 Death: 1854
Jonas was the fourth child of ten children born to Peter Miller and Mary Stutzman. He married Catherine Hershberger. They moved to Holmes County, Ohio and lived near Walnut Creek. They were Amish-Mennonites. They had four sons and six daughters; two children died single. One son, Moses J. Miller, also called Klein Mose or Glee Mose (Little Mose) was a leading minister in the formation of the Old Order Amish.
Source: "Anniversary History of the Family of John "Hannas" Miller, Sr. (ca. 1730-1798)" by J. Virgil Miller pg 49
